Understanding AI Writing Patterns
Before you can effectively modify AI-generated text, you need to recognize the characteristic patterns that appear in its writing:
Structural Formulas
AI essays often follow predictable organizational structures:
- Rigid five-paragraph format even when inappropriate
- Nearly identical paragraph lengths throughout
- Overly symmetrical treatment of opposing viewpoints
- Formulaic transitions between sections
Language Patterns
Look for these telltale linguistic signatures:
- Repetitive sentence structures and openers
- Overuse of certain transitional phrases
- Consistently moderate sentence length with limited variation
- Generic academic phrases ("In conclusion," "It is important to note")

Common Pitfalls in the Reverse Engineering Process
When modifying AI-generated essays, be careful to avoid these common mistakes:
Superficial Editing
Making only cosmetic changes (word substitutions, minor rewording) without addressing deeper structural or analytical issues.
Inconsistent Voice
Creating a patchwork essay with noticeably different writing styles between original AI text and your modifications.
Over-Complexity
Adding unnecessary jargon or complexity in an attempt to sound more sophisticated, resulting in writing that's less clear and less effective.
A Note on Academic Integrity
Reverse engineering AI content requires careful consideration of academic integrity policies. In many educational contexts, submitting AI-generated content as your own work—even if modified—may violate academic honesty standards. Always:
• Check your institution's policies on AI use
• Consult with instructors about acceptable use of AI tools
• Consider using these techniques for learning purposes rather than submission
• Properly cite AI assistance when permitted and appropriate
